The question

Is the harm mentioned regarding masturbation only health-related?

Share this answer

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 20261 min readAlso available in العربية
The answer

Some may exaggerate the harms of masturbation, but the root of the harm exists and relates to health aspects, including weakened libido after marriage, and its effect on erection and premature ejaculation, which impacts the marital relationship. Islamic law prohibits that which contains corruption and harms; Allah Almighty said: "Indeed, Allah enjoins justice, and the doing of good, and generosity towards relatives, and He forbids indecency, and wickedness, and oppression. He admonishes you, that you may take heed." The corruption extends beyond health harm, and if it were of the permissible kind, the Prophet, peace be upon him, would have recommended it to the youth.
